
The Devon Cricket Foundation is delighted to confirm that Welden & Edwards have committed to supporting the Devon Cricket Performance Pathway until at least the end of the 2026 season.
The Tiverton-based estate agency became the front-of-shirt sponsor of all Devon Performance Pathway teams and Devon Women at the start of the 2024 season.
"Welden & Edwards are proud sponsors of the Devon Cricket Performance Pathway," says Managing Director, Dean Edwards. "We believe in nurturing local talent and empowering young cricketers to reach their full potential.
"Just as cricket embodies teamwork, perseverance and excellence, we strive to reflect these values in our commitment to the community. Together, we are shaping the future of cricket in Devon."
The Performance Pathway was expanded in September 2024, with complete parity being achieved between the Boys' and Girls' County Age Group pathways. Our partnership will see Welden & Edwards' logo continue to appear on the front of all 16 Performance Pathway shirts.
Speaking on the continued partnership, Devon Cricket Foundation CEO, Matt Theedom, said:
"Welden & Edwards have played a big part in helping us remove financial barriers for players in Devon to achieve their potential, and we are delighted that our partnership will be continuing to help us improve the quality of cricket for our talented players in the future."
